gpt4 book ai didi

java - 如何找到自动装箱?

转载 作者:行者123 更新时间:2023-12-02 06:29:02 26 4
gpt4 key购买 nike

我的代码经常使用自动装箱,例如,当我将方法的返回值从 int 更改为 byte 时,它​​会产生错误,因为它不会再自动装箱为 Byte。

void addTag(String name, Object value) {...}
int /*was byte*/ getValue() {...}

addTag("Type", getValue());

为了防止错误,我将所有这些转换为显式装箱,例如 new Byte(getValue())

在 Eclipse 中出现警告,但在 NetBeans(我们使用 7.0.1)中我找不到此提示。有谁知道如何找到自动(取消)拳击?它不一定是提示/警告,只要我能以简单的方式找到它们即可。

我不能尝试的事情:

  • 使用 Eclipse 或 NetBeans 插件(我使用的是 protected 公司 PC)
  • 将编译器设置为低于 1.5(它不可用,并且无论如何都会生成太多错误)

最佳答案

尝试使用PMD , FindbugsCheckstyle 。应该有可用的 Netbeans 插件。

关于java - 如何找到自动装箱?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20238006/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com